The narrator pulls the reader into the action
In the paragraph beginning "But that did the business for me", the narrator engages the reader by creating suspense and intrigue through the use of dramatic language and a sudden revelation. By utilizing vivid imagery and an unexpected turn of events, the narrator captivates the reader's attention and draws them into the unfolding story.
